Transaction 7e65c34f581abcc67478f3b3946fae4af1f327e095b9d342caba7e1baa9119ae

block
83cae00fea24a3973770f339380f58947e353343ba1c36b6fbdb65e7b778ce54

1 Input

25 Outputs